-Stamps-The Snowflake Spot, Seeing Spots, Snow Flurries, and Spot On Jumbo wheel
-Ink-Purely Pomegranate, Soft Sky and Blue Bayou
-Paper-Purely Pomegranate, Soft Sky,Blue Bayou and Whisper White; Cutie Pie DSP
-Accessories-Hodgepodge hardware, Blue Bayou and Purely Pomegranate double stitched ribbon and Ticket Corner Punch.
This piece of hodgepodge I've actually never used before. I have a ton of them because I've never found a use for them. The Pomegranate ribbon was run through first and tied around the inner rectangle, then the Blue Bayou piece was run through.
